crEATe

This book looks brilliant.   crEATe is based upon research by trend analysts from the London firm The Future Laboratory. investigates recent trends and visual developments in and around food. The book examines everything from the way we eat, the interiors and furniture of innovative restaurants and shops, industrial design and the packaging of food to branding and consumerism.Create1Create2Create3Create4

Book Design

Book_desgin
Book_design2
Book_design_3

Fully Booked presents a choice selection of artist books. Created by hand and printed in limited editions, these publications push the boundaries of conventional book design.

It presents material from printed publications that succeed in striking a crucial balance – between the market’s demands for availability, legibility and durability on the one hand and sophisticated visual and content design on the other. By featuring projects in this experimental field that combine enormous creativity with skilled craftsmanship, Fully Booked also reveals trends in today’s graphic design.

Get London Reading

Books100
Books_101
Get London Reading is a campaign to um.... get London reading. They produced a great site with a Rough Guide to London by the book , which you can download for free, and a really useful interactive online map.

There was also a brilliant graffiti campaign across London in April, which included quotes from books stencilled all over the place. Lots more pics here on flickr. Really beautiful...

Richard's Crowdsourcing Entry

Crowd_3
Richard Weston, author of much admired typography blog Acejet 170 has submitted this beautiful entry for the cover of the new book Crowdsourcing by Jeff Howe, editor of WIRED.

The book hopes to generate an impact comparable to similar genre bestsellers The Wisdom of Crowds by James Surowiecki, The Long Tail by Chris Anderson, and Blink by Malcolm Gladwell.
